Job Description:

Parsons is looking for an amazingly talented Electrical Engineer to join our team! In this role you will get to support our government client on exciting and important projects related to our national security.

What You'll Be Doing:
  • While this effort does not involve performing actual construction activities, it will require close coordination with ongoing construction projects to meet critical deadlines, address logistical challenges, and minimize disruptions to operations. Personnel with relevant backgrounds in areas such as construction management, infrastructure planning, and financial oversight will play a key role in navigating technical, logistical, and financial requirements while ensuring compliance with the customer's stringent security protocols and operational standards. This role will support the completion of a wide range of Electrical Engineering assignments, including such things as analysis of technical issues, review of technical documents, performance of field inspections, and development of technical papers.
  • Evaluate, design, develop, test, and oversee the procurement, manufacturing, installation, and maintenance of electrical components in medium and low voltage electrical systems.
  • Serve as a subject matter expert (SME) for medium and low voltage electrical systems across mission-critical facilities.
  • Identify operational and security gaps in electrical systems that are a risk to mission-critical operations.
  • Develop master plans and mitigation strategies to minimize risks and increase resiliency in electrical systems.
  • Collaborate with multidisciplinary engineering teams, third-party contractors, and other government agencies to install, repair, commission, and maintain electrical systems.
  • Ensure compliance with electrical codes and industry standards through detailed calculations and developing technical specifications.
  • Develop maintenance and testing procedures for electrical and electronic components.
  • Strong organizational, communication, problem-solving, and leadership skills.
  • Experience in designing or assessing electrical systems for mission-critical facilities, to include battery and generator backup power.
  • Experience with Supervisory Control and Data Acquisition (SCADA) systems, power metering, and electrical automation systems.
  • Proven expertise with design and calculation software.
  • Deep knowledge of electrical engineering codes.

What Required Skills You'll Bring:
  • Active Top Secret security clearance
  • Requires a Bachelor's degree in Electrical Engineering (Master's degree or Professional Engineer license preferred).
  • Over five years of experience in medium and low voltage electrical distribution, infrastructure management, and power engineering.
  • Good communication and analytical skills
  • Working knowledge and proficiency with Microsoft Office suite of word processing and integrated software applications.

Security Clearance Requirement:
An active Top Secret security clearance is required for this position.
